## Deploying the Gatewick Proctor Queue

Deploys are pretty painless: push to main, wait for the pipeline, then watch the queue drain dashboard for five minutes. If candidates pile up mid-exam, roll back first and ask questions later — the queue replays safely. Everything the workers care about lives in one config block, shown here for reference.

settings of bafof-yagef:
JOROX_PIN=8740
JOROX_TENANT=pelox
JOROX_METRICS_HOST=metrics.jorox.qorvelworks.internal
JOROX_SEAL=seal_c78f63c1
JOROX_STANDBY_TEAM=norax

## Changelog — Font vendoring defaults changed

As of this release, the Bracken UI build no longer fetches third-party fonts at build time. All typefaces used by the Lanternwell suite are now vendored into the repo under a dedicated assets directory, and the fetch step is skipped by default. If you're onboarding, nothing to install — the fonts travel with the checkout. The build flags controlling this behavior are listed below.

settings of hadup-yafog:
LAMAEL_PIN=3761
LAMAEL_TENANT=istmir
LAMAEL_METRICS_HOST=metrics.lamael.plorvasys.test
LAMAEL_SEAL=seal_8ea68500
LAMAEL_STANDBY_TEAM=fraok

## Releases

Wanderhall audio-guide builds ship monthly, timed to the Ostbrook Museum exhibit calendar. Tag the release, run the packaging script, and sign the bundle before uploading to the distribution shelf — unsigned bundles are rejected by the kiosk updaters. Contractors use the shared release identity, not personal credentials. The current release signing key appears below.

signing key of baduf-taweg = bky6_Zf7bem